Mortgages are the backbone of home ownership and an important way to generate wealth in the U.S. They’re also an investment that’s becoming harder to pay off for many Americans.
A recent report shows that borrowers of all ages are dipping into retirement savings to pay down long-term debt, and many are doing so to pay for housing expenses. Of those surveyed, the generational breakdown using retirement savings for housing costs is:
- 28% of baby boomers
- 16% of Gen Xers
- 14% of millennials
- 5% of Gen Zers
Generally, first-time qualified homebuyers can use up to $10,000 tax-free from their retirement accounts to purchase a home. However, dipping into additional retirement savings to pay for housing can incur tax implications that may be more detrimental to long-term savings and livelihoods.

How is the All In One Loan different from traditional mortgages?
With a traditional mortgage, the majority of your payments in the early years go toward interest rather than principal, making them slow to pay off.
The All In One Loan doesn’t prioritize interest payments. Instead, every dollar you deposit into your checking account is immediately applied to reduce your mortgage principal balance. Interest is calculated daily, so the lower the balance on your mortgage, the less interest you owe.
If my checking account is tied to my mortgage, do I still have access to my money?
Yes! You can access your money just like you do today via ATM, check, online and mobile banking, and bill pay. It’s still your money, it is simply working harder for you.
